Baptista: Roma can reach top four
Saturday 29 November, 2008

Julio Baptista believes Roma’s revival can take them all the way to a top four finish in Serie A and Europe.

The team got off to a disastrous start including embarrassing defeats to Cluj, Siena and Genoa, but are back in business with three straight wins in all competition.

“We know that we have a game in hand and can get there, but it depends on us. If we win the matches that are there to be won, then I think we can finish fourth in Serie A,” said the Brazilian.

They currently have 14 points from 12 games, but have to play Sampdoria in January, as that fixture was rained off.

It would be quite a comeback, as right now Roma are 10 points adrift of Napoli in fourth place.

They face a crucial showdown on Sunday afternoon against rivals for fourth place Fiorentina.

“We are improving at this moment and that is what we needed. You can see that the team is playing better football.”

The 3-1 victory away to Cluj midweek meant the Giallorossi would finish ahead of Chelsea to top the group if they beat Bordeaux at the Olimpico, but at the same time qualification is not yet secure.

“The teams that are going through to the next phase are all very strong, like Manchester United, Real Madrid, Juventus and Chelsea. The side with fewer problems will be the one that makes the difference.”

Baptista hopes Roma have had their fair share of problems at the start of the season so the rest will be plain sailing.

One of the crucial turning points was Luciano Spalletti’s introduction of a 4-4-2 with a diamond midfield.

“Every Coach has to evaluate the situation when things aren’t working and what needs to be changed. He did that and I think the new system is working very well. The players feel they belong with these tactics.”
